Ingredients
7cupswatermeloncubed
1/4cupfresh lime juiceand lime slices for garnish
1bottlefruity white wine, like a Moscato
1literplain Seltzer water or Soliel Sparkling Water
1pintfresh blueberries
1/4mintfor garnish
Instructions
Blend 7 cups of watermelon until smooth. Strain through a mesh strainer to remove any seeds or pulp, reserving the juice.
Add fresh watermelon juice, lime juice, and white wine to a large pitcher. Stir to incorporate.
Chill for 2-4 hours.
Before serving, stir again and add fruit to the pitcher. Fill a glass with ice. Pour in the watermelon mixture until the glass is ⅔ full. Top off the glass with chilled seltzer water.
Garnish with fresh blueberries, strawberries, mint and watermelon cubes if desired.
